HC Deb 10 July 1979 vol 970 c161W
Sir Nicholas Bonsor

asked the Secretary of State for Social Services what action he proposes to take to prevent the closure of the Migraine clinic, 22 Charter House Square, London EC1.

Sir George Young

Since 1973, the Department has been making a grant annually to the Migraine Trust towards the non-research running costs of the Princess Margaret migraine clinic. This grant has been given on the understanding that it could not be a continuing grant and that help should be sought from other sources, including the health authorities for the population served by this clinic. My right hon. Friend has recently agreed a further grant of £15,000 for the current financial year to give the trust a longer period to seek alternative help.
